Beijing's best-seller lists no open book
By Todd Balazovic and Du Juan | China Daily | Updated: 2010-03-01 08:15
Some publishers build buzz for titles, but numbers aren't exactly binding
Everyone enjoys having friends recommend a good book, but what happens when friends suggest books that are average at best?
This is just the case with Beijing's best-selling book lists, Yao Danqian, vice-president of marketing at dangdang.com, one of China's leading online bookstores, told METRO.
